Our 2016 income is more than our income for 2015. We were instructed to make estimated state tax payments. Now working on the taxes for the year 2016, we are getting a refund on our state tax even before we enter our estimated state tax payments we made during 2016. Our Federal tax is not reduced by entering estimated state tax payments ($2400).

Your estimated tax payments (both federal and state) are entered under the federal portion of your program. Then those payments will be fed into your state program automatically.
You definitely want to enter them so you'll get credit for those payments on your state return. (Your state refund will be even greater)!
